First we ride, then we eat! Enjoy the sights and sounds of the city and learn about Detroit’s Jewish history with Michigan Jewish Historical Society’s annual J-Cycle bike tour. Meet at Shed #6 in Eastern Market at 9:30 AM sharp.
Every rider must have their own helmet and bike (and you have to wear the helmet!).
If you need to rent a bike you can check out MoGo located nearby at the intersection of Gratiot Ave and Russel St, but you’ll also need to bring a helmet!
$20 per person. This subsidized price is only for NEXTGen Detroit participants (ages 21-45). You must register no later than August 11. We cannot accept walk-ins.
All J-Cycle riders get a $10 voucher to spend at Hazon’s Jewish Food Festival afterwards!
